Exploring SEO and SEM Strategies for Business Growth

In this digital age, increasing traffic and boosting your website’s visibility are crucial for business growth. Two of the most prominent strategies to achieve this are Search Engine Optimization (SEO) and Search Engine Marketing (SEM). While both aim to increase your presence on search engines, they differ significantly in approach. Choosing between them depends on your business goals, budget, and timeline. Let’s break down SEO vs. SEM to help you determine which strategy is best for your business growth.

 

 

Understanding SEO: A Long-Term Investment

SEO is the process of optimizing your website organically to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s). SEO primarily focuses on improving content, website structure, keyword usage, and earning backlinks to drive more traffic over time.

 

Advantages of SEO:

  • Cost-Effective: Once you achieve higher rankings, maintaining them requires less ongoing investment than SEM. You don't need to pay for each click or impression.

  • Long-Term Results: SEO growth is progressive, providing long-term rewards that continue to deliver value well into the future.

  • Credibility and Trust: Ranking organically gives your business a sense of credibility. Users are more likely to trust businesses.

 

Understanding SEM: Fast Results with a Price

SEM is a broader term that includes both SEO and paid search strategies like Pay-Per-Click (PPC) advertising, typically through platforms like Google Ads. SEM involves paying for ad placements on search engines, allowing businesses to appear at the top of the search results instantly.

 

Advantages of SEM:

  • Immediate Results: SEM gives you almost instant visibility. As soon as your ad campaign is live, your business can start appearing at the top of search results.

  • Complete Control Over Budget: You can control how much you spend daily, meaning SEM is flexible for businesses with varying budgets.

  • Great for Short-Term Campaigns: If you’re running a limited-time offer or launching a product, SEM is ideal for fast, measurable outcomes.

 

Challenges of SEM:

  • Costs Add Up: Unlike SEO, SEM costs are ongoing, as you pay for every click. In competitive industries, costs can rise quickly.

  • Ad Fatigue: Users may ignore your ads after seeing them multiple times, leading to diminishing returns.

  • Short-Term Results: SEM brings fast results, but once your budget runs out or the campaign ends, the traffic stops.

 

When to Use SEO

  • You’re looking for sustainable, long-term growth.

  • You have time to wait for results.

  • Your budget is limited, and you prefer not to pay for each visitor.

 

When to Use SEM

  • You need immediate traffic and conversions.

  • You’re running a limited-time offer or product launch.

  • You have the budget to invest in ongoing campaigns.

 

Both SEO and SEM play crucial roles in business growth, but the best strategy depends on your specific needs. If you’re looking for quick wins and have a budget to spend, SEM will provide instant visibility. However, if you want sustainable growth and higher credibility over time, investing in SEO is essential. For many businesses, a balanced approach by using SEM for short-term gains and SEO for long-term sustainability—can lead to optimal results.
